Output 2efea6588677a6fa028dfa5c87be3f56be72f7b56b64a91adbc91399a6d1e909:1

value
12816186
script pubkey
OP_DUP OP_HASH160 OP_PUSHBYTES_20 95569344b6db355a0dd706757aa68719884cf0f8 OP_EQUALVERIFY OP_CHECKSIG
address
1EcdPwPcfKbeLemstLLtGyZeP1uxAVu988
transaction
2efea6588677a6fa028dfa5c87be3f56be72f7b56b64a91adbc91399a6d1e909
confirmations
503363
spent
true